Sullins Dee Freeman Governor Director Secretary June 24, 2009 CERTIFIED MAIL: RETURN RECEIPT REQUESTED Dale Crisp, Director of Public Utilities City of Raleigh One Exchange Plaza, Suite 620 Raleigh, NC 27602 DWQ Project # 06-1144, Ver. 4 Wake County Subject Property: City of Raleigh Dempsey Benton Water Treatment Plant Project - Permit Modification Request Ut to Walnut Creek [030402, 27-34-(4), C, NSW] RETURN OF APPLICATION Dear Mr. Crisp: On June 2, 2009, the Division of Water Quality (DWQ) received your application dated May 29, 2009, to fill or temporarily impact 25 linear feet of perennial stream, 115 linear feet of intermittent stream, and permanently impact 4,500 square feet of Zone 1 Neuse River basin protected riparian buffers and 3,000 square feet of Zone 2 Neuse River basin protected riparian buffers to install a waterline at the site. On June 17, 2009, the DWQ received your response to our June 11, 2009, "Request For More Information" correspondence. Your responses to the requests (restated below) from that correspondence were inadequate. 1. Please re-submit your site plans on full plan sheets at a scale of no smaller than 1 "=50' with topographic contours shown. 2. Please provide a detailed planting plan for the buffers (standard format includes: scientific name, common name, source of the plant material, plant spacing, wetland indicator status, etc., as well as planting specifications). 3. Please indicate all stream impacts including all fill slopes, dissipaters, and bank stabilization on the site plan. 4. Please enumerate all riparian buffer impacts on the site plan and clearly label impacts (Buffer Impact 1, etc.). 5. Please locate all isolated or non-isolated wetlands, streams, and other waters of the State as overlays on the site plan. 6.
